1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o vs. 2005 Pontiac Vibe
To start off, 2005 Pontiac Vibe is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o would be higher. At 2,351 cc (4 cylinders), 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o (127 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 4 more horse power than 2005 Pontiac Vibe. (123 HP @ 5200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o should accelerate faster than 2005 Pontiac Vibe.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Pontiac Vibe weights approximately 32 kg more than 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o.
Let's talk about torque, 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o (193 Nm) has 33 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Pontiac Vibe. (160 Nm). This means 1989 Mitsubishi Sapporo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Pontiac Vibe.
